Liberty, a prominent financial services organisation, is seeking a strategic Manager for their Fund Solutions Data & Analytics team based in Johannesburg. This is an exciting opportunity to shape how data and analytics are leveraged within a complex multi-manager environment, driving significant improvements in reporting, decision-making, and operational efficiency.
About the Role
The core purpose of this position is to champion the delivery of impactful data and analytics solutions for Liberty's Fund Solutions division. You will be instrumental in transforming the organisation's data strategy into tangible assets, including integrated datasets, insightful dashboards, robust controls, and automated processes. The ultimate goal is to establish a reliable single source of truth for fund and operational information, thereby enhancing data accessibility, ensuring superior quality, and fostering greater utilisation of this critical information across the business. This role demands a proactive approach to improving reporting workflows, reducing manual effort, and contributing to the automation and redesign of analytical processes.
Key Responsibilities
Your responsibilities will encompass a broad spectrum of data and analytics management, focusing on translating strategic objectives into actionable data products. Key duties include:
- Developing and implementing integrated datasets that consolidate information from diverse sources.
- Designing and deploying insightful dashboards and reporting tools to provide clear business intelligence.
- Establishing and maintaining strong data quality controls to ensure accuracy and reliability.
- Driving automation initiatives to streamline data processing and reporting workflows.
- Collaborating closely with business, operations, and reporting stakeholders to understand their needs and translate them into effective data solutions.
- Resolving delivery issues and ensuring the successful implementation of data products.
- Contributing to the redesign and enhancement of analytical processes to maximise efficiency and insight generation.
- Acting as a key enabler for better day-to-day decision-making by providing readily accessible, high-quality information.
What They're Looking For
Liberty is seeking a candidate with a strong foundation in data management and analytics, coupled with significant experience in the financial services sector. A relevant first degree in fields such as Information Studies, Information Technology, Mathematical Sciences, or Finance and Accounting is required.
Essential experience includes:
- 3-4 years of experience focused on improving reporting workflows, reducing manual intervention, and contributing to automation or redesign of analytical processes.
- 3-4 years of experience integrating data from multiple sources, implementing data quality controls, and producing repeatable reporting or insight outputs for business consumption.
- 3-4 years of experience working collaboratively with business, operations, or reporting stakeholders to translate requirements into usable data products and effectively resolve delivery issues.
- A substantial 5-7 years of experience delivering data, analytics, dashboarding, business intelligence, or reporting solutions, ideally within financial services, investment management, or a similarly regulated environment.
Candidates should demonstrate strong behavioural competencies such as adopting practical approaches, articulating information clearly, meticulous attention to detail in checking things, effective persuasion skills, and a commitment to developing their expertise. Technical competencies in continuous process improvement, data analytics, data compliance, data development, and data discovery are crucial for success in this role.

In South Africa, managerial positions in data and analytics within the financial services sector can command competitive salaries, often ranging from R700,000 to over R1,200,000 per annum, depending on experience, seniority, and the specific organisation. Liberty, as part of Standard Bank Group, is a major player in the African financial landscape, offering a stable and growth-oriented career path.
